Description

A funny collection of football poems by Brian Bilston, the unofficial Poet Laureate of Twitter. Perfect for football fans of all ages - from the young footie fanatic to a been-to-every-game-grandma, and every 'I could've been a pro' in between.

Full of poems that will make you giggle about all things football, including being left out of the World Cup squad, mum's opinion on Messi vs Ronaldo, or those unmissable fixtures:

I'd love nothing more than to go outside
and spend time with Mother Nature.
But what can I do? It's out of my hands:
Nigeria are playing Croatia

50 Ways to Score a Goal and Other Football Poems includes witty chants, a haiku or two, and fun shape poems about the beautiful game. Laugh together through the Euros or Premier League games, and swap the half-time pundits for puns!

About the Author
Brian Bilston has been described as the Banksy of poetry and Twitter's unofficial Poet Laureate. With over 100,000 followers across all social media platforms, including J. K. Rowling, Roger McGough, Ian Rankin and Grayson Perry, Brian has become truly beloved by the Twitter community. His work includes the poetry collection You Took the Last Bus Home, his first novel Diary of a Somebody which was shortlisted for the Costa Prize, and his collection Alexa, what is there to know about love? is full of poems about love in all its forms.
